About this app

Support Dash Cam:
1. DR02P
2. DR02PL
3. DRS1
4. DR02DPL
5. DRM1
AukeyDash works with all of AUKEY's dash cams and is completely free to use.

The app works fine with my camera and the quality of image is great as well. However, the wifi download feature doesn't make much sense. Is extremely slow to download files to the cellphone e while it says that I can view it on the phone gallery afterwards the video is just on the app itself. It doesn't get saved anywhere on the phone. No way to export it. How are you supposed to send to your insurance of you can't take the video of the app? This should be the most basic feature of it.

At first, the app seemed to do nothing after connecting except go back to the connect screen. Turns out, you must have an SD card installed and formatted for the camera to function. (My old one was apparently corrupted. A new one got things working.) The app description claims to offer the convenience of not needing an SD card to store files, but this is misleading.
